Solana’s Bold Leap: How Its Experimental Ideas Are Becoming Regulated Market Solutions

Imagine a laboratory where the wildest ideas in finance are born. Now, picture those same ideas powering the world’s most secure banks. According to a top JPMorgan executive, this is precisely the journey Solana’s experimental concepts are taking. At the recent Solana Breakpoint conference, Scott Lucas, Global Head of Digital Assets at JPMorgan, made a compelling case: the blockchain’s most challenging innovations are evolving into robust Solana regulated market solutions. This signals a major shift where crypto’s frontier spirit meets the rigorous demands of global finance.

What Did JPMorgan Actually Say About Solana?

Scott Lucas didn’t just offer polite praise. He delivered a powerful endorsement of Solana’s development process. Speaking directly to the ecosystem’s builders, Lucas stated that the ‘challenging ideas’ emerging from Solana often mature into frameworks suitable for regulated environments. He emphasized that true innovation springs from the clash of diverse perspectives and open debate. For a traditional finance giant like JPMorgan, this represents a significant acknowledgment. It shows they are not just watching from the sidelines but actively listening to absorb the energy and direction of the Solana community.

What are ‘regulated market solutions’ in crypto?
These are blockchain-based products, services, or protocols designed to operate within existing financial regulations. They offer crypto’s benefits (like speed and transparency) while ensuring compliance with laws for anti-money laundering (AML) and investor protection.

BitGo expands its presence in Europe

The post BitGo expands its presence in Europe app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. BitGo, global leader in digital asset infrastructure, announces a significant expansion of its presence in Europe. The company, through its subsidiary BitGo Europe GmbH, has obtained an extension of the license from BaFin (German Federal Financial Supervisory Authority), allowing it to offer regulated cryptocurrency trading services directly from Frankfurt, Germany. This move marks a decisive step for the European digital asset market, offering institutional investors the opportunity to access secure, regulated cryptocurrency trading integrated with advanced custody and management services. A comprehensive offering for European institutional investors With the extension of the license according to the MiCA (Markets in Crypto-Assets) regulation, initially obtained in May 2025, BitGo Europe expands the range of services available for European investors. Now, in addition to custody, staking, and transfer of digital assets, the platform also offers a spot trading service on thousands of cryptocurrencies and stablecoins. Institutional investors can now leverage BitGo’s OTC desk and a high-performance electronic trading platform, designed to ensure fast, secure, and transparent transactions. Aggregated access to numerous liquidity sources, including leading market makers and exchanges, allows for trading at competitive prices and high-quality executions.
